This shift impacts banks, as P2P lenders like LendingClub and Prosper compete directly, costing institutions like JPMorgan revenue.\u003c\/p\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003c\/section\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"image-section image-2_new_design\"\u003e\n \u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/5FORCES-Content-Substitutes-Image.svg\" alt=\"Explore a Preview\"\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003csection class=\"highlight-box\"\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"highlight-icon\"\u003e\n \u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/5FORCES-Content-Substitutes-Arrows-Icon-Color-1.svg\" alt=\"Icon\"\u003e\n \u003ch3\u003eNon-Bank Financial Services\u003c\/h3\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"highlight-content\"\u003e\n \u003cp\u003eNon-bank financial services pose a threat to Columbia Bank. These services, including wealth management and insurance, directly compete with traditional banking products. Regulatory changes are influencing borrowers to seek mortgages and commercial credit from non-bank entities. As of late 2024, non-bank lenders held approximately 60% of the U.S. mortgage market, highlighting the shift. This competition could erode Columbia Bank's market share and profitability. \u003c\/p\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003c\/section\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"product-orange-section\"\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"product-box-orange-section4\"\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"title-row-orange-section\"\u003e\n \u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/5FORCES-Content-Substitutes-Arrows-Icon-Color-2.svg\" alt=\"Icon\"\u003e\n \u003ch3\u003eDigital Wallets\u003c\/h3\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"content-row-orange-section blur_box\"\u003e\n \u003cp\u003eDigital wallets pose a threat to Columbia Bank by offering convenient alternatives for financial transactions. Compliance costs and complexity are significant challenges. For example, new banks must meet stringent capital requirements, such as those set by the Basel III accord, which includes minimum capital ratios, with Common Equity Tier 1 capital at 4.5% of risk-weighted assets. These barriers make it tough to compete with established banks like Columbia Bank. \u003c\/p\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003c\/section\u003e\n \u003csection class=\"sub-highlight-box\"\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"sub-highlight-icon\"\u003e\n \u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/5FORCES-Content-Entrants-Lamp-Icon-Color-1.svg\" alt=\"Icon\"\u003e\n \u003ch3\u003eCapital Requirements\u003c\/h3\u003e\n \u003c\/div\u003e\n \u003cdiv class=\"sub-highlight-content\"\u003e\n \u003cp\u003eNew banks face substantial capital demands for infrastructure and regulatory compliance, which restricts market entry.
